Description

Conveying device for aluminum product machining
Technical Field
The utility model relates to a relevant technical field of aluminum product processing specifically is a conveyor is used in aluminum product processing.
Background
Products made of aluminum and other alloy elements are usually made by first processing aluminum into castings, forgings, foils, plates, strips, pipes, bars, profiles and the like, and then performing the processes of cold bending, sawing, drilling, splicing, coloring and the like.
Current conveyor is inconvenient carrying out the spray rinsing processing to the aluminum product at the in-process of carrying the aluminum product to be difficult to guarantee the clean and tidy nature of aluminum product, to above-mentioned problem, need improve current equipment.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ides a technical solution: the utility model provides a conveyor is used in aluminum product processing, as shown in fig. 1 and 2, the bottom of plummer 1 is fixed with auto-lock gyro wheel 2, and the top of plummer 1 rotates and is connected with cylinder 5, the interior top of plummer 1 is fixed with storage water tank 6, and the right side of storage water tank 6 and the bottom of storage water tank 6 all are fixed with electronic water valve 7, the front side at the top of plummer 1 is fixed with first motor 3, and the rear side of first motor 3 rotates and is connected with belt drive 4, belt drive 4 runs through the preceding lateral wall of plummer 1 simultaneously and is connected with cylinder 5, cylinder 5 equidistance distributes at the top of plummer 1, belt drive 4 can rotate under the effect of first motor 3, thereby drive cylinder 5 clockwise turning, conveniently guide the aluminum product of moving to the right, so that the aluminum product is carried in succession.
According to the illustration of fig. 1, 2 and 3, the spray mechanism 8 is fixed on the top of the bearing platform 1, the bottom of the spray mechanism 8 is connected with the water storage tank 6, the spray mechanism 8 comprises a water pump 801, a connecting pipe 802, a water delivery channel 803, a bracket 804 and a spray nozzle 805, the water pump 801 is fixed on the inner bottom of the water storage tank 6, the connecting pipe 802 is fixed on the rear side of the water pump 801, the connecting pipe 802 penetrates through the rear side wall of the water storage tank 6 and the rear side of the bracket 804 to be connected with the water delivery channel 803, the bracket 804 is fixed on the top of the bearing platform 1, the water delivery channel 803 is fixed on the inner top of the bracket 804, the spray nozzle 805 is fixed on the bottom of the water delivery channel 803, the spray nozzles 805 are distributed at equal intervals, water in the water storage tank 6 can be sprayed out through the connecting pipe 802, the water delivery channel 803 and the spray nozzle 805 in sequence under the action of the water pump 801 during the rightward movement of the aluminum product, so as to facilitate the spray treatment of the aluminum product, the spray heads 805 distributed equidistantly can make the spray effect more comprehensive and uniform.
According to the figures 1, 2 and 4, the right side of the spray washing mechanism 8 is provided with a support plate 9, the support plate 9 is fixed on the front side and the back side of the upper end surface of the bearing platform 1, the second motor 10 is fixed on the front side of the front support plate 9, the back side of the second motor 10 is rotatably connected with a squeezing barrel 11, in the process of absorbing the moisture on the surface of the aluminum material by using the absorbent cotton 14, the squeezing barrel 11 can rotate clockwise under the action of the second motor 10, so as to squeeze the moisture in the absorbent cotton 14 conveniently, so that the absorbent cotton 14 can continuously exert the function of absorbing water, the squeezing barrel 11 and the rotating barrel 13 are rotatably connected between the support plates 9, the squeezing barrel 11 is positioned on the left side of the rotating barrel 13, the third motor 12 is fixed on the front side of the front support plate 9, the back side of the third motor 12 is rotatably connected with the rotating barrel 13, the absorbent cotton 14 is fixed on the outer surface of the rotating barrel 13, and the aluminum material after being washed is moved rightwards, the drum 13 can rotate counterclockwise under the action of the third motor 12, and the absorbent cotton 14 can closely contact with the upper end surface of the aluminum material to complete the water absorption operation.
The working principle is as follows: when the conveying device for aluminum processing is used, an external power supply is connected, an electric water valve 7 on the right side of a water storage tank 6 is opened to supply water into the water storage tank 6, the electric water valve 7 is closed after the water supply is finished, an aluminum material is placed on a roller 5, a first motor 3 is started, the first motor 3 drives a belt transmission device 4 to rotate, so that the roller 5 is driven to rotate clockwise, the aluminum material is guided to move rightwards, a water pump 801 is started at the same time, water in the water storage tank 6 is sprayed out through a connecting pipeline 802, a water conveying channel 803 and a spray head 805, the aluminum material is cleaned, after the water flows back into the water storage tank 6, a filter screen in the water storage tank 6 can filter the water, the water can be recycled, a second motor 10 and a third motor 12 are started at the same time, the third motor 12 drives the roller 13 to rotate anticlockwise, and a water absorption cotton 14 is tightly attached to the upper end face of the aluminum material to finish water absorption operation, the second motor 10 drives the extrusion cylinder 11 to rotate clockwise, so as to squeeze water in the absorbent cotton 14, so that the absorbent cotton 14 can continuously play a role of absorbing water, and after the work is finished, the electric water valve 7 at the bottom of the water storage tank 6 is opened, water in the water storage tank 6 can be discharged, so that the whole work is completed, and the content which is not described in detail in the specification belongs to the prior art which is known by technicians in the field.
